Hi all

I'm 21 weeks at the moment and still haven't felt my baby move. I can't wait for that butterfly feeling everyone keeps telling me about.

Everything I've read says it happens between 16 and 24 weeks. However, my evil boss keeps banging on about how there is something wrong because I haven't felt anything yet and how I should go get checked out. My 20 week scan was perfectly fine.

Do you think I should be worried?

Xxx

I felt movements with my first around 20 weeks i think.

Do you know if your placenta is posterior or anterior? That affects the feeing of movements

Baby160P · 13/10/2018 12:09

I have a anterior placenta and feel movement very low. It turns out although it's anterior it's high anterior. If you have mid anterior placenta it's hard to feel? Maybe ask or check your notes?
